Lawrence, Kansas, is a place where neighbors often ask about the cost to replace a cement driveway, and the answer isn't a simple number. What influences the price is the scope of the project. For example, the size of the driveway, how thick the new concrete needs to be, and whether the old driveway needs to be completely removed and hauled away all play a part. Decorative finishes, like stamping or exposed aggregate, will also add to the overall cost compared to a standard smooth finish. The pros who come out will look at the site in Lawrence to give you a precise breakdown. They consider the condition of the existing base and any grading needed for proper drainage. Tuck pointing for concrete in Lawrence involves carefully removing old, crumbling grout or mortar from cracks and joints. The pros then clean out the void to ensure a good bond for the new material. They use a specialized mix that matches the original color and texture as closely as possible. This process strengthens the concrete structure and improves its appearance. It’s a detailed repair that extends the life of your concrete features.
Concrete driveways in Lawrence offer durability and a clean look, often at a lower initial cost than pavers. They can be customized with various finishes. Paver driveways offer flexibility, intricate patterns, and easier repair of individual units. However, pavers can be more expensive upfront and may require more maintenance to prevent shifting.
